Output 66ce1e7770f35cda050fa87f7fedf9678af44cc195c97df9c4e425c97d54a631:0

value
27906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b40eea9bb71513580f1edb93a1a22da9ffe07f51 OP_EQUAL
address
3J75RV7dpLVw8cUjpHbGpbagVNCE3BFbLr
transaction
66ce1e7770f35cda050fa87f7fedf9678af44cc195c97df9c4e425c97d54a631
spent
true